Madison - Fern Marty Zweifel passed away on Sunday, October 13, 2013 at Agrace HospiceCare. She was born on the Donald Farm near Mt. Vernon, WI on May 16, 1918 to Malena (Lee) and Mathias Marty. Later the family moved to the New Glarus and Belleville area. Fern graduated from Belleville High School in 1936. On June 23, 1940 she married Alvin Zweifel of New Glarus. They resided in Madison. Fern worked at Gimbels for 17 years before retiring. She was a den mother for cub scouts for many years. Belonged to the Madison Gem & Mineral Club. She and her husband enjoyed the club for many years. Also, they went on many fishing outings together and lots of traveling. Hobbies were making quilts for all her children and grandchildren. Also, she and her husband enjoyed gardening together which she kept on doing after his passing. Fern was a member of Mt. Olive Lutheran Church. Proceeded in death by her husband, Alvin; her parents; sisters, Virginia "Gin" Heimann, Verda "Babe" Lovelace; brother, Lincoln "Bud" Marty. Survivors include three sons, Ronald (Raya) Zweifel of Hot Springs Village, Arkansas, Richard (Shirley) Zweifel of Madison, WI, Marty (Tanya) Zweifel of Stoughton; one sister-in-law, Mary Wealti; five grandchildren; nine great-grandchildren; many nieces and nephews, cousins and friends.
